Quarterly Planning Note — Branch Managers

The Kestwick pilot lost 14% of enrolled customers last quarter, double forecast. Exit interviews cite onboarding friction and pricing confusion on the Bramley tier. Fixes: simplified sign-up by week 4, single price card, dedicated retention calls for at-risk accounts. Branches in Oldenreach and Tarsley will trial the revised flow first. Churn above 8% next quarter triggers a pilot pause. Report weekly numbers to regional ops. The wider plan this pilot feeds into is noted below.

management briefing: Project Ulavan slips by two quarters because of the staffing delay.

**CI note: timezone weirdness in report exports**

Heads up, support folks — if a customer says their Ledgerpine export shows times shifted by a few hours, it's probably the CI image. The export workers got rebuilt last week and the base image defaults to UTC, while older workers used the account's locale. Fix is rolling out; meanwhile tell customers the data itself is fine, just the display offset. Affected exports carry the build token shown below.

build token for bajof-tahop: htk4_a981

Ticket: Config drift on Scanlark barcode integration

Welcome aboard — this one is a good starter. The warehouse nodes in the Eastvale depot have drifted from the reference config for the Scanlark scanner bridge: two hosts are running an older decode timeout and a deprecated symbology list, which is causing intermittent misreads on damaged labels. Please audit all four nodes against the baseline and reconcile any differences, then restart the bridge service. The reference configuration the nodes should match is as follows:

settings of fafog-haduf:
ZORIX_PIN=4648
ZORIX_METRICS_HOST=metrics.zorix.paliqsys.corp
ZORIX_LOG_LEVEL=info
ZORIX_TENANT=druix